Runbook: extracting the user module from the Granitebay monolith. During cutover windows, traffic for profile reads is mirrored to the new Userspire service while writes remain on the monolith. If divergence alarms fire, pause the mirror via the Splitgate console, then compare row counts between the legacy `users` table and the Userspire store. Do not resume until counts match within the documented tolerance. To query the Splitgate reconciliation API from the bastion, authenticate with the service key provided below.

gateway credential: kto23_LX9A4ys6i4nzHtpOLNLodKK

**Mgmt Meeting Minutes — Retiring the Brightline Range**

Quick recap for sales leads at Fenholt Supplies: we agreed to retire the Brightline fixture range by year-end. Remaining stock moves to clearance pricing next month, and accounts on standing orders get migrated to the Lumetta range. Trade-in incentives were approved in principle. The confidential note on next steps sits just below.

board note of bajof-bajeg: The pricing group signed off on a budget of $13.4 million for Project Sildor. The renewal with Lamixek Holdings closes at $48.9 million a year, 49 percent above the last contract.

Leadership Review: Warranty-Cost Overrun, Veltrix Line

Warranty claims on the Veltrix HC-2 exceeded forecast by 38% this quarter, driven by a seal defect in early production batches. Remediation is funded; supplier accountability discussions are underway. For the incoming director, the plan this connects to is summarized confidentially below.

board note of tadup-tajog: Headcount on the Oliiel team goes from 31 to 88 by the end of February. Gross margin on Oliiel came in at 62 percent against a plan of 29 percent.